Girl Scout Alumnae
Once a Girl Scout. Always a Girl Scout.

How can people make the world a better place? One significant way is by participating in, or contributing to, an annual week-long, day camp for girls ages six through 12. For 20 years Camp Sunshine has been doing just that - making the world a better place.

Since 1912, millions of women's lives have been positively influenced–sometimes even transformed–by their Girl Scout experience. Whether you are one of the millions of women who were Girl Scouts, including Brownie Girl Scouts, or you were a volunteer or staff member who worked at the national or local level to help Girl Scouts reach their full potential, you are forever connected to a rich and vibrant movement.

Stay Connected, Change a Girl’s Life
As a Girl Scout Alumnae, you know firsthand how transforming a positive program can be in a girl’s life. Whether you are actively involved with Girl Scouts or not, you can stay connected through the local and national Girl Scout Councils.

Network, Have Fun!
This is an effort to find Girl Scout Alumnae. We are looking for women who want to:

  • connect with other former Girl Scouts in the area
  • learn what Girl Scouting is doing today to help girls grow strong
  • hear from current Girl Scouts about their wonderful projects and adventures
  • return to camp for a weekend of Girl Scout fun
  • join the national alumnae association to look for your former Troop members
And, you will have fun and help make the world a better place.
